Identificador de Regra
CHA-900DLUBC01
Módulo: CHA - Chão de Fábrica.
Finalidade: Ao clicar no botão "Mostrar" da tela de baixa de componentes (F900BAC), a regra deste identificador será executada para cada componente que for inserido na grade da tela e que possua controle por lote, sendo possível definir através da regra, qual o lote que deverá ser carregado automaticamente para cada componente.
O lote informado na regra aparecerá na grade sem que seja feita consistência alguma ao mostrar as informações, pois já há consistências ao processar as informações da tela.
Obs.: A partir da versão 5.5.1.13 (22/05/09), a regra deste identificador também será executada na tela F917CBC.
Tela: Baixa de componentes da O.P. (F900BAC)
Transação: Não se aplica.
Regra:
Deve estar ligado a uma regra.
Exemplo de regra:
Definir Alfa VSCodOri;
Definir Numero VNumOrp;
Definir Alfa VSCodCmp;
Definir Alfa VSCodDer;
Definir Alfa VSCodLot;
Se ((VSCodOri = "40") e (VSCodCmp = "PRLOTE"))
VSCodLot = "0001-158";
Senao
VSCodLot = "12345";
Variáveis Disponibilizadas:
Nome | Tipo | Observações | Retorna Valor |
---|---|---|---|
VSCodOri | ALFA | Origem da O.P. do componente | N |
VNumOrp | NÚMERO | Número da O.P. do componente | N |
VSCodCmp | ALFA | Código do componente | N |
VSCodDer | ALFA | Derivação do componente | N |
ChaACodDep | ALFA | Código do depósito onde o componente foi reservado | N |
VSCodLot | ALFA | Código do lote a ser utilizado pelo componente | S |
Atenção
Caso o parâmetro global LisVarReg esteja habilitado, a variável ListaVariaveis estará disponível em todos os identificadores de regras do sistema. O conteúdo desta variável lista os campos disponibilizados no identificador de regras em questão.
Não é aconselhada a ativação desse parâmetro global para o uso cotidiano. Esse recurso de listagem dos campos de identificadores auxilia a construção de regras e o Suporte para, por exemplo, depuração ou quando não houver acesso à documentação dos identificadores de regras.